Charles Copeland Morse House

text: The Charles Copeland Morse House was the home of Charles Copeland Morse, founder of the Ferry-Morse Seed Company. It is located in Santa Clara, California, and is a California Historical Landmark (#904), as well as listed on the National Register of Historic Places. This house is a classic Queen Anne Victorian.
